# [3.1.0](https://github.com/revanced/revanced-patcher/compare/v3.0.0...v3.1.0) (2022-08-02)
### Features
* validator for patch options ([4e2e772](https://github.com/revanced/revanced-patcher/commit/4e2e77238957d7732326cfe5e05145bf7dab5bfb))
# [3.0.0](https://github.com/revanced/revanced-patcher/compare/v2.9.0...v3.0.0) (2022-08-02)
### Features
* registry for patch options ([2431785](https://github.com/revanced/revanced-patcher/commit/2431785d0e494d6271c6951eec9adfff9db95c17))
### BREAKING CHANGES
* Patch options now use the PatchOptions registry class instead of an Iterable. This change requires modifications to existing patches using this API.
# [2.9.0](https://github.com/revanced/revanced-patcher/compare/v2.8.0...v2.9.0) (2022-08-02)
### Bug Fixes
* show error message instead of `null` ([8d95b14](https://github.com/revanced/revanced-patcher/commit/8d95b14f350b47ec029f35e776f6e627aaf5f607))
### Features
* exclusive mutable access to files ([814ce0b](https://github.com/revanced/revanced-patcher/commit/814ce0b9ae29725417c86b7d11b40d025724a426))
